Strongs Number: H7646


Hebrew Word
שָׂבַע
Transliteration
sâbaʻ
Phonetic
saw-bah'
Part of Speech
Verb
Strongs Definition

to {sate} that {is} fill to satisfaction (literally or figuratively)

BDB Definition

1. to be satisfied, be sated, be fulfilled, be surfeited

a. (Qal)

1. to be sated (with food)

2. to be sated, be satisfied with, be fulfilled, be filled, have one's fill of (have desire satisfied)

3. to have in excess, be surfeited, be surfeited with 1a

b. to be weary of (fig)

c. (Piel) to satisfy

d. (Hiphil)

1. to satisfy

2. to enrich

3. to sate, glut (with the undesired)

Origin
A primitive root
Bible Usage
have {enough} fill ({full} {self} {with}) be (to the) full ({of}) have plenty {of} be {satiate} satisfy ({with}) {suffice} be weary of.
